Visa and Mastercard postpone new crypto partnerships

Sources report that Visa and Mastercard are delaying the launch of new blockchain and crypto partnerships until market conditions improve and clearer regulatory frameworks emerge.

Mastercard and Visa postpone the launch of crypto products

On February 28, Reuters released a report showing that US payment processors Visa and Mastercard have delayed launching new partnerships with crypto companies due to the industry’s major bankruptcies that have led to increased regulatory scrutiny.

This decision comes after a period of increasing collaboration between the payment giants and crypto companies, as the popularity of cryptocurrencies exploded. For example, Mastercard examined payments in USD Coin weeks before the recent developments, and Visa focused on stablecoin settlements.

Waiting for better market conditions and regulations

According to sources, both Visa and Mastercard are said to be delaying the launch of certain products and services related to crypto until market conditions and regulations improve. The delays are reportedly not affecting their core businesses, which sources say remain strong, but are caused by the uncertain regulatory environment for crypto in light of the collapse and bankruptcies of centralized digital asset custody companies such as Celsius, FTX, Three Arrow Capital, Voyager Digital and others in the past year. A Visa spokesperson stated:

The failure of some prominent companies in the crypto sector reminds us that there is still a long way to go before crypto becomes a normal part of payments and financial services.
